Tastings range from 110e to 160e to 230e.
Wine pairings seemed on the high side at 150e for the grand tasting for all courses
you could chose the wine pairing for just the savory courses for I believe 120e
The wine list ranged from the acceptable 65e ish to 5000 for an aged first growth
